NICE Recommends Ibrutinib for Relapsed/Refractory MCL

December 16th 2017

The United Kingdom's National Institute for Health Care and Excellence has published new guidelines recommending ibrutinib as treatment for patients with relapsed/refractory mantle cell lymphoma.

Lenalidomide Plus Rituximab Safe and Effective as Initial Treatment for MCL

December 10th 2017

Lenalidomide (Revlimid) plus rituximab (Rituxan) is a feasible combination that is also safe and active, as initial and maintenance therapy for patients with mantle cell lymphoma.
